您是否為網站載入速度緩慢而苦惱?讀完本文,您將能:
- 掌握網站速度優化的核心概念與重要性
- 學習實用的網頁效能分析和診斷技巧
- 了解如何透過程式碼優化、圖片壓縮和快取機制提升網站速度
- 深入探索伺服器設定與CDN的應用
- 建立持續監控和改進網站速度的機制
讓我們一起深入探討,打造最佳瀏覽體驗!
為什麼網站速度優化至關重要
在競爭激烈的網路世界中,網站速度不再只是額外的優勢,而是決定成敗的關鍵因素。快速的網站能提升使用者體驗,降低跳出率,增加頁面瀏覽時間,最終提升轉換率和搜尋引擎排名。慢速的網站則會導致使用者流失、品牌形象受損,甚至影響商業收益。
網頁效能分析與診斷
優化網站速度的第一步是了解目前網站的效能瓶頸。透過各種工具和技術,我們可以分析網頁載入時間、找出效能瓶頸,並針對性地進行優化。常用的工具包括Google PageSpeed Insights、GTmetrix、WebPageTest等,這些工具能提供詳細的效能報告,指出需要改進的地方,例如:減少HTTP請求、優化圖片、縮減CSS和JavaScript檔案大小等。
Google PageSpeed Insights 的使用
Google PageSpeed Insights 是一款免費且易於使用的工具,它能分析您的網站速度,並提供具體的改進建議。使用步驟如下:1. 進入Google PageSpeed Insights 網站;2. 輸入您的網站網址;3. 等待分析結果;4. 根據報告提供的建議,逐一進行優化。
其他效能分析工具
除了Google PageSpeed Insights,還有許多其他的效能分析工具,例如GTmetrix和WebPageTest。這些工具提供不同的功能和數據指標,可以幫助您更全面地了解網站效能。選擇適合您需求的工具,並定期監控網站速度,才能及時發現和解決問題。
程式碼優化技巧
優化網站程式碼是提升網站速度的關鍵步驟。良好的程式碼結構、高效的演算法和有效的快取機制都能有效縮短網頁載入時間。以下是一些程式碼優化的技巧:
減少HTTP請求
減少HTTP請求可以有效縮短網頁載入時間。您可以透過合併CSS和JavaScript檔案、使用CSS Sprites、使用資料庫快取等方式來減少HTTP請求。
優化圖片
圖片是網頁載入速度的重大影響因素。您可以透過壓縮圖片、使用適當的圖片格式(例如WebP)、使用懶載入等方式來優化圖片。
縮減CSS和JavaScript檔案大小
您可以透過壓縮CSS和JavaScript檔案、移除不必要的程式碼、使用程式碼最小化工具等方式來縮減檔案大小。
伺服器設定與CDN
伺服器設定和CDN (內容傳遞網路) 也會影響網站速度。選擇效能良好的伺服器,並使用CDN可以加快網頁載入速度,尤其對於全球用戶來說,CDN更是至關重要。您可以考慮使用雲端伺服器,例如AWS、Google Cloud Platform或Azure,這些平台提供高性能、高可靠性的伺服器和CDN服務。
持續監控與改進
網站速度優化是一個持續的過程,需要定期監控和改進。您可以使用效能監控工具,例如Google Analytics和New Relic,來監控網站速度,並及時發現和解決問題。
網站速度優化案例分享
以下分享幾個網站速度優化成功的案例,說明如何透過不同的策略提升網站速度,並帶來實際效益。案例一:某電商網站透過圖片優化和CDN部署,將網頁載入速度提升了50%,進而提升了轉換率和銷售額。案例二:某新聞網站透過程式碼優化和伺服器升級,將網頁載入速度提升了30%,降低了跳出率,提升了使用者體驗。
案例 | 優化策略 | 效能提升 | 效益 |
---|---|---|---|
案例一 | 圖片優化、CDN部署 | 50% | 提升轉換率和銷售額 |
案例二 | 程式碼優化、伺服器升級 | 30% | 降低跳出率,提升使用者體驗 |
結論
網站速度優化是一個持續的過程,需要不斷的學習和實踐。透過網頁效能分析、程式碼優化、伺服器設定和CDN的應用,以及持續的監控和改進,您可以打造一個快速、流暢的網站,提升使用者體驗,最終提升您的商業目標。希望本文能幫助您提升網站速度,創造最佳瀏覽體驗!
常見問題 (FAQ)
如何快速診斷網站速度問題?
可以使用Google PageSpeed Insights、GTmetrix或WebPageTest等工具分析網站效能,找出速度瓶頸。
圖片優化有哪些方法?
可以透過壓縮圖片、使用適當的圖片格式(例如WebP)、使用懶載入等方式優化圖片。
CDN如何提升網站速度?
CDN將網站內容複製到全球各地的伺服器,讓用戶可以從距離最近的伺服器獲取內容,縮短載入時間。
網站速度優化需要持續監控嗎?
是的,網站速度優化是一個持續的過程,需要定期監控和改進,才能保持最佳效能。
有哪些工具可以監控網站速度?
可以使用Google Analytics、New Relic等工具監控網站速度。